RESPONSECODE IFDHCloseChannel(DWORD Lun)
This function should close the reader communication channel for the particular reader.
RESPONSECODE IFDHGetCapabilities(DWORD Lun, DWORD Tag, PDWORD Length, PUCHAR Value)
This function should get the slot/card capabilities for a particular slot/card specified by Lun.
RESPONSECODE IFDHSetProtocolParameters(DWORD Lun, DWORD Protocol, UCHAR Flags, UCHAR PTS1, UCHAR PTS2, UCHAR PTS3)
This function should set the Protocol Type Selection (PTS) of a particular card/slot using the three ...
RESPONSECODE IFDHSetCapabilities(DWORD Lun, DWORD Tag, DWORD Length, PUCHAR Value)
This function should set the slot/card capabilities for a particular slot/card specified by Lun.
RESPONSECODE IFDHCreateChannelByName(DWORD Lun, LPSTR DeviceName)
This function is required to open a communications channel to the port listed by DeviceName.
RESPONSECODE IFDHControl(DWORD Lun, DWORD dwControlCode, PUCHAR TxBuffer, DWORD TxLength, PUCHAR RxBuffer, DWORD RxLength, LPDWORD pdwBytesReturned)
This function performs a data exchange with the reader (not the card) specified by Lun.
RESPONSECODE IFDHICCPresence(DWORD Lun)
This function returns the status of the card inserted in the reader/slot specified by Lun.
RESPONSECODE IFDHTransmitToICC(DWORD Lun, SCARD_IO_HEADER SendPci, PUCHAR TxBuffer, DWORD TxLength, PUCHAR RxBuffer, PDWORD RxLength, PSCARD_IO_HEADER RecvPci)
This function performs an APDU exchange with the card/slot specified by Lun.
RESPONSECODE IFDHCreateChannel(DWORD Lun, DWORD Channel)
This function is required to open a communications channel to the port listed by Channel.
RESPONSECODE IFDHPowerICC(DWORD Lun, DWORD Action, PUCHAR Atr, PDWORD AtrLength)
This function controls the power and reset signals of the smart card reader at the particular reader/...

RESPONSECODE IFDCloseIFD(READER_CONTEXT *rContext)
Close a communication channel to the IFD.
RESPONSECODE IFDOpenIFD(READER_CONTEXT *rContext)
Open a communication channel to the IFD.
LONG IFDControl(READER_CONTEXT *rContext, DWORD ControlCode, LPCVOID TxBuffer, DWORD TxLength, LPVOID RxBuffer, DWORD RxLength, LPDWORD BytesReturned)
Provide a means for toggling a specific action on the reader such as swallow, eject,...
RESPONSECODE IFDGetCapabilities(READER_CONTEXT *rContext, DWORD dwTag, PDWORD pdwLength, PUCHAR pucValue)
Gets capabilities in the reader.
LONG IFDStatusICC(READER_CONTEXT *rContext, PDWORD pdwStatus)
Provide statistical information about the IFD and ICC including insertions, atr, powering status/etc.
LONG IFDTransmit(READER_CONTEXT *rContext, SCARD_IO_HEADER pioTxPci, PUCHAR pucTxBuffer, DWORD dwTxLength, PUCHAR pucRxBuffer, PDWORD pdwRxLength, PSCARD_IO_HEADER pioRxPci)
Transmit an APDU to the ICC.
RESPONSECODE IFDSetCapabilities(READER_CONTEXT *rContext, DWORD dwTag, DWORD dwLength, PUCHAR pucValue)
Set capabilities in the reader.
RESPONSECODE IFDSetPTS(READER_CONTEXT *rContext, DWORD dwProtocol, UCHAR ucFlags, UCHAR ucPTS1, UCHAR ucPTS2, UCHAR ucPTS3)
Set the protocol type selection (PTS).
RESPONSECODE IFDPowerICC(READER_CONTEXT *rContext, DWORD dwAction, PUCHAR pucAtr, PDWORD pdwAtrLen)
Power up/down or reset's an ICC located in the IFD.
